From the initial state filing to ongoing compliance, each piece of LLC paperwork serves a distinct role. The Articles of Organization, for instance, is the foundational document filed with your state to officially create the LLC. An Operating Agreement, though not always legally required by every state, is vital for defining ownership, management, and operational procedures.
